About This Course
Turning innovation into protected property
This course gives you a working understanding of patents, the patenting process, trademarks, copyrights, and the other forms of protection that make up intellectual property. Patents are essential components of the high-technology business landscape, and these materials explain how and why patents are issued, how they are asserted against infringers, and how they can sometimes be challenged and invalidated.
Beyond patents, the course covers trademarks, copyrights, and trade secrets, so you can tell which form of protection fits a given business asset. It then follows a patent through its full life — from patentable subject matter and claim drafting, through prosecution, to validity challenges, pre-litigation, trial, and the remedies available when rights are infringed.
